Transaction 21a1123e5c186560429b2f643043931da34b5a12c4d753a62d79451c62390a44

1 Input
2 Outputs
  • 21a1123e5c186560429b2f643043931da34b5a12c4d753a62d79451c62390a44:0
  • value  684910000
    address  1Ct9uzNYFpXXJPjGzVHmfFzd2yumusFifN
  • 21a1123e5c186560429b2f643043931da34b5a12c4d753a62d79451c62390a44:1
  • value  585292189
    address  1Lsqcv4cg5zUctNi2qwNxMkrv1GeBboSUJ